The sun is classified as Main sequence and dwarf star on the Hertzsprung-Russell diagram.
Basically, the main sequence dominates the HR diagram. It stretches from the upper left (hot, luminous stars) to the bottom right (cool, faint stars). The sun is simply one of the countless stars in the universe.

In the study of stellar evolution, one of the major tools is Hertzsprung Russell Diagram (HR diagram). It was developed by Ejnar Hertzsprung and Henry Norris Russell in the 1990s.
The diagram plots the temperature of stars against their luminosity. Based on its initial mass, the evolutionary stages that every star goes through are determined by its internal structure and how its energy is produced.
All the revolutionary changes corresponds to a luminosity and change in temperature of the star, which moves to different regions as it progresses on the HR diagram.
The HR diagram presents a group of stars according to their evolutionary stages and one the crucial features on the diagram is the main sequence.
Apart from the main sequence, the other 2 main regions of the HR diagram include: the red giant and the white dwarf.
